Transaction 61e8094bc8453f344ab6394b18657a3f6551841225f827be50a58766f56c1df6
1 Input
1 Output
-
61e8094bc8453f344ab6394b18657a3f6551841225f827be50a58766f56c1df6:0
- value
- 135439
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b21a1309d4713eedc201b4ed698481168cb229e
- address
- bc1qdvs6zvyaguf7ahpqrd8ddxzgz95vkg57m8wjqn